The randot stereoacuity test is a visual assessment tool that helps determine a person’s ability to perceive depth and three-dimensional vision. This is crucial for activities such as driving, sports, and even everyday tasks like pouring a glass of water. The test utilizes random dot patterns that are presented in varying degrees of depth and disparity to evaluate the patient’s stereoacuity or depth perception.

The test involves the patient wearing special glasses with red and green lenses that allow each eye to see a different set of random dot patterns. The patient is then asked to identify a specific pattern or object that appears to be floating in space. By measuring the smallest disparity that the patient can perceive, eye care professionals can determine the level of stereoacuity or depth perception.

The Randot Stereoacuity Test is particularly useful for patients who have undergone eye surgeries such as cataract removal, refractive surgery, or strabismus correction. These procedures can sometimes affect the alignment of the eyes and the ability to perceive depth accurately. By conducting the Randot Stereoacuity Test, eye care professionals can monitor the patient’s progress and adjust their treatment plan accordingly.

Another group of patients who can benefit from the Randot Stereoacuity Test are those with amblyopia or lazy eye. Amblyopia is a condition where one eye has significantly reduced vision due to inadequate visual stimulation during childhood. This can lead to poor depth perception and binocular vision. The Randot Stereoacuity Test helps in assessing the severity of amblyopia and developing a treatment plan to improve the patient’s vision.

In addition to diagnosing and monitoring vision problems, the Randot Stereoacuity Test is also essential for evaluating the success of vision therapy or orthoptic treatment. Vision therapy is a customized program designed to improve binocular vision, eye coordination, and depth perception. By using the Randot Stereoacuity Test before and after vision therapy, eye care professionals can measure the patient’s progress and make any necessary adjustments to the treatment plan.
